cablet
English
Etymology
cable +? -let
Noun
cablet (plural cablets)
- A slender cable.

cabler
English
Etymology 1
cable +? -er
Noun
cabler (plural cablers)
- Someone who cables, who puts together or fixes cables.
Etymology 2
cable +? -er (“Variety -er”)
Noun
cabler (plural cablers)
- (entertainment) A cable television network or system operator.
